H.4.1 Factors Affecting Reserve Balances of Depository Institutions

BOARD OF GOVERNORS OF THE FEDERAL RESERVE SYSTEM H.4.1 (For Immediate Release) June 24, 1954 Revised CONDITION OF THE FEDERAL RESERVE BANKS Member Bank Reserves and Related Items During the week ended June 23, Member bank reserves decreased $89 million. The principal changes reducing reserves were increases of $7bl million in Treasury deposits with Federal Reserve Banks and $140 million in Other deposits with Federal Reserve Banks. The principal offsetting changes were an increase of $749 million in Reserve Bank credit and a decrease of $68 million in Money in circulation. The increase of $749 million in Reserve Bank credit resulted from increases of $473 million in Loans. discounts and advances, $229 million in U. S. Government securities bought outright, and $92 million in U. S. Government securities held under repurchase agreement, and a decrease of $46 million in Float, Holdings of U. S. Government securities bought outright reflected an increase of $229 million in bills. Estimated required reserves reflect the lower reserve requirements on time deposits of country banks, announced during the week, which were made effective as of June 16 and which reduced required reserves approximately $182 million.
